Output ce8e998588866f15525be894ba5ce6825dc1f2ddee39ec5c6aaee75daf90b45a:23

value
2535386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cd23832c3de7e9c3f819c0941aef8ad5d271fbf OP_EQUALVERIFY OP_CHECKSIG
address
1Q3o7ehGdM1zVh889B6ifRzt2DbtqQU8DZ
transaction
ce8e998588866f15525be894ba5ce6825dc1f2ddee39ec5c6aaee75daf90b45a